Lyneal Trust Accessible canalside cottage holidays and Narrowboat hire all in beautiful north Shropshire.

A fantastic facility for people with disabilities or other vulnerabilities. Enjoy a trip along the wonderful Llangollen Canal and experience some of the best countryside and wildlife in the UK. You can book a day trip or hire one of our accessible narrowboats for a week's gentle cruise or stay with family and friends at our canalside Wharf Cottages to enjoy the Meres and Mosses of North Shropshire's Lakeland.

North Shropshire MP, Helen Morgan will visit the Lyneal Trust on Friday 29 May to meet spinal injury patients from The Robert Jones and Agnes Hunt Orthopaedic Hospital during a canal trip on the Llangollen Canal near Ellesmere.

“Lyneal Trust holiday boat, Shropshire Maid, crossing the aqueduct at Chirk on its way back from Llangollen, having been over the world famous Pontcysyllte Aqueduct and the 1,400 foot long Chrik Tunnel".

This holiday afloat could provide a family, with a disabled member, a trip that they never thought possible. See our website for full details www.lyneal-trust.org.uk .
